The Tony Award®-winning Woolly Mammoth Theatre Company creates badass theatre that highlights the stunning, challenging, and tremendous complexity of our world. For over 40 years, Woolly has maintained a high standard of artistic rigor while simultaneously daring to take risks, innovate, and push beyond perceived boundaries. One of the few remaining theatres in the country to maintain a company of artists, Woolly serves an essential research and development role within the American theatre. Plays premiered here have gone on to productions at hundreds of theatres all over the world and have had lasting impacts on the field. Currently co-led by Artistic Director Maria Manuela Goyanes and Interim Managing Director Ted DeLong, Woolly is located in Washington, DC, equidistant from the Capitol and the White House. Located in Washington, D.C., Woolly stands upon the ancestral homeland of the Nacotchtank whose descendants belong to the Piscataway peoples.

--- The themes explored in this play are definitely worth our attention. The two male leads give lovely, nuanced, naturalistic performances, as does the actor playing a largely silent household servant. And, considering its title, the play itself is surprisingly sentimental. The playwright, though. really should have enlisted someone other than himself to direct the play. An objective voice is needed to trim the unnecessarily lengthy script. And the projections - text messages as well as surtitles to translate the non-English segments of dialogue - were, unfortunately, largely illegible, even in the relatively intimate Woolly space. Nonetheless, seeing PUBLIC OBSCENITIES is recommended. ---
